Title:   Cup Fragment with Rouletting: Gray Ware
Category:   Pottery
Description:   Single piece of rim and wall, with stumps of a handle. Roundish body, plain incurved rim with a flat band on inside. Remains of a vertical flat/ovoid-sectioned looped handle on upper wall. Vertical gouging around belly, remains of a narrow band of very fine rouletting below the rim.
Smooth light gray ware with thin gray-black slip, part polished and worn on exterior.
Asia Minor (?) ware, related to Knidian?; cf. ware of P 8144.
